Error when using SLO with Backend Prometheus

svenmueller opened this issue · 8 comments

I get an error when using an SLO with backend class "Prometheus".

---
service_name:      product
feature_name:      search
slo_name:          freshness
slo_description:   95% of messages in queue are fresh
slo_target:        0.95
backend:
  class:           Prometheus
  method:          good_bad_ratio
  url:             ${prometheus_url}
  measurement:
    filter_good:  <query-1>
    filter_valid:  <query-2>
exporters:
- class:           Stackdriver
  project_id:      ${stackdriver_host_project_id}

Error when running TF (missing field changes with each run):

Error: Invalid value for module argument

  on main.tf line 130, in module "product_search_freshness":
 130:   config                     = local.slo_config_map["product-search-freshness"]

The given value is not suitable for child module variable "config" defined at
.terraform/modules/product_search_freshness/modules/slo/variables.tf:41,1-18:
attribute "slo_target": number required.

Ok, found the error: it seems like the backend block requires a project_id field, and Terraform is trying to enforce that. Please add a project_id field to your backend section and it should work:

---
service_name:      product
feature_name:      search
slo_name:          freshness
slo_description:   95% of messages in queue are fresh
slo_target:        0.95
backend:
  class:           Prometheus
  method:          good_bad_ratio
  project_id:      test
  url:             ${prometheus_url}
  measurement:
    filter_good:  <query-1>
    filter_valid:  <query-2>
exporters:
- class:           Stackdriver
  project_id:      ${stackdriver_host_project_id}

Since Prometheus does not have a project_id per say, we need to remove this requirement for this type of backend.

It's worth noting that Terraform error is really wrong here, and that there is nothing wrong with the YAML or the slo_target number ...

This PR is the fix to avoid having to specify the useless project_id: #43
